Lightbulb OpenSource WebDB Framework??

I've used LAMP and used wordpress, OpenOffice and even naked PHP to build database apps.

What I'd like to find is an OpenSource framework that provides the ability to build a database online. I'd like to host my own private ZOHO Creator like website. I've looked at RubyonRails and expected that there would be something there, but it doesn't look like it's there.

Just to summarize.
  • A web framework to create database apps hosted by MySQL that does not require any programming. Do the whole thing with web interfaces, like you build a blog using Wordpress and friends.
  • Create forms, create tables, create views, maybe reports.
  • Allow embedding of views in other sites.
  • Don't need charts, or other fancy things. Yet.
  • Sort of OpenOffice Base for the web.
ZOHO Creator does it all and is very nice, but their cost structure is onerous. $15/mo for several large databases - 3 "apps" and a few records is free. This seems very high compared with my $5/mo unlimited/unlimited/unlimited hosting account.

Is this out there yet? I've looked for a while, but can't find it. We sure need this don't we?

Checkt Drupal, particularly the contributed modules CCK and Views. You can build complex web applications without a lick of code.

Thanks. I've looked at both Drupal and Joomla, which has a similar plug-in called FLEXIcontent. Both are ok for small amounts of data, and certainly add greatly to the flexibility of these environments, but the ease of use of these plug-ins is no where near that of ZOHO Creator.
